HMD Vibe2 5G Launches in India With Android 16, 6000mAh Battery Under Rs 10,000
HMD has launched the new Vibe2 5G smartphone in India, targeting the sub-Rs 10,000 segment with features like Android 16, a 120Hz display, and a 6000mAh battery.
The smartphone will go on sale starting May 26 at 12 PM through Flipkart. HMD is offering the device in two storage variants, with launch pricing starting at Rs 9,499.

The company says the Vibe2 5G is designed around everyday usability, focusing on battery life, smooth performance, and AI-backed features.
120Hz Display and IP64 Rating
The HMD Vibe2 5G comes with a 120Hz refresh rate display aimed at smoother scrolling and animations during daily use.
HMD has also added IP64-rated water and dust resistance, which is still relatively uncommon in this price range.
The phone will be available in Cosmic Lavender, Nordic Blue, and Peach Pink colour options.
50MP AI Camera and Android 16
For cameras, the device features a 50MP dual rear camera setup with AI-backed image processing designed to improve shots in different lighting conditions.
On the front, there’s an 8MP selfie camera with support for portrait enhancements and artificial light correction.
The Vibe2 5G runs Android 16 out of the box and includes support for Indus by Sarvam AI as part of HMD’s India-focused software experience.
Big Battery and 5G Connectivity
The smartphone packs a 6000mAh battery and ships with an 18W charger inside the box.
HMD says the phone uses adaptive battery optimisation to improve endurance during day-to-day usage.
Powering the device is an octa-core 2.3GHz processor, although the company hasn’t specified the exact chipset name in the announcement.
HMD Vibe2 5G Price in India
The HMD Vibe2 5G is available in the following variants:
- 4GB + 64GB
- 4GB + 128GB
The launch price starts at Rs 9,499 for a limited period.
Sales begin on May 26 exclusively via Flipkart.
